0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

一种可用于单片机的0-10V模拟量采集电路(二)

CHANBAEK 来源:硬件实战君 作者:硬件实战君 2023-03-16 14:30 次阅读

上篇文章分享了一种0-10V传感器信号采集电路。 为拓展电路设计中解决问题的思维,这篇文章再给大家介绍一种0-10V采集电路。 电路如下图所示:

wKgZomQStz-AXLVkAAHtUOVq0J0372.jpg

使用运放构成了差分放大电路,对输入信号进行运算处理,将0-10V变化的模拟量信号转化为0-3.3V变化的模拟量信号。

对此电路的放大倍数进行推导:

wKgZomQStz-AUUR1AAAKvy-D8Fc476.jpg

wKgZomQStz-APKUpAAAKNBQju6A252.jpg

联立以上式子得:

wKgaomQStz-ACe-aAAAKF8_l8-4319.jpg

可知以上电路将0-10V信号放大了0.33倍,成功的将0-10V信号转化到了单片机ADC能够正常读取的电压范围,仿真波形如下图。

wKgZomQStz-AIeVRAAAn5rwxHO0191.jpg

电路应用注意事项:

上述仿真波形与理论推导很符合,是不是你去找个运放芯片搭建个电路就能做出如此完美的效果呢? 来看看下面这张图。

wKgaomQStz-AHxA2AAC86kryKu0701.jpg

同样的电路与参数,输出电压确是从1V多开始变化的,而不是从零开始变化。 差异就在于我更换了一个运放芯片。 运放OPA101相比于LM6132A输入输出都不是Rail-to-rail(轨至轨)的,所以就产生了上述仿真波形中的差异。

在0-10V传感器采集电路中运放应该选取输入输出轨至轨运放,保证输出电压从0V开始变化。 其次,电路中使用的电阻应选取精度为1%的精密电阻。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 传感器
    +关注

    关注

    2551

    文章

    51106

    浏览量

    753621
  • 单片机
    +关注

    关注

    6037

    文章

    44558

    浏览量

    635363
  • 运放
    +关注

    关注

    47

    文章

    1165

    浏览量

    53095
  • 模拟量
    +关注

    关注

    5

    文章

    491

    浏览量

    25550
  • 采集电路
    +关注

    关注

    3

    文章

    28

    浏览量

    12281
收藏 人收藏

    评论

    相关推荐

    一种可用于单片机0-10V模拟量采集电路()

    在嵌入式系统中会用到0-10V电压信号输出的传感器。 而单片机ADC引脚的输入电压却比较低。 如STM32引脚输入电压最高为3.3V,高于3.3V会导致
    发表于 03-16 14:30 1.2w次阅读
    <b class='flag-5'>一种</b><b class='flag-5'>可用于</b><b class='flag-5'>单片机</b>的<b class='flag-5'>0-10V</b><b class='flag-5'>模拟量</b><b class='flag-5'>采集</b><b class='flag-5'>电路</b>(<b class='flag-5'>一</b>)

    一种可用于单片机的中断高效处理与事件机制方法

    一种可用于单片机的中断高效处理与事件机制方法
    的头像 发表于 10-17 15:08 746次阅读

    如果要用单片机作为0-10V输出应该怎么做?(请看下描述谢谢)

    我打算用单片机然后搭配块DA芯片输出0-10V模拟量,但是被控制的那个用电器要求信号的负极和用电器的负极是同
    发表于 05-10 15:23

    一种基于ATtiny13的模拟量隔离采集电路介绍

    ,占用资源也多;串行A/D芯片可以节省不少光耦,但需要复杂的时序才能完成对A/D的读写操作。本文提出一种使用集成A/D的微型单片机ATtiny13进行模拟量隔离采集,使用单根数据线完成
    发表于 07-16 06:00

    PLC的0-10v模拟量怎么转换成数字的?

    举例说明,假如你的0-10V模拟量,对应PLC的数字量是0-4096或者0-16383,按照0-4096举例
    的头像 发表于 07-09 15:53 3.7w次阅读
    PLC的<b class='flag-5'>0-10v</b><b class='flag-5'>模拟量</b>怎么转换成数字的?

    使用51单片机模拟量采集串口显示的程序和工程文件合集免费下载

    本文档的主要内容详细介绍的是使用51单片机模拟量采集串口显示的程序和工程文件合集免费下载。
    发表于 09-19 17:04 14次下载
    使用51<b class='flag-5'>单片机</b><b class='flag-5'>模拟量</b><b class='flag-5'>采集</b>串口显示的程序和工程文件合集免费下载

    0-10V和4-20mA在PLC模拟量输出模块中的应用

    模拟量输入模块和模拟量输出模块。 模拟量输出模块般有0-5V0-10V和4-20mA以及
    的头像 发表于 10-21 10:18 9316次阅读
    <b class='flag-5'>0-10V</b>和4-20mA在PLC<b class='flag-5'>模拟量</b>输出模块中的应用

    什么是模拟量,它的概念是怎样的

    模拟量是什么? 模拟量是指些连续变化的物理,如电压、电流、压力、速度、流量等信号模拟量
    发表于 03-03 14:59 3w次阅读

    模拟量采集器是什么,它的原理是怎样的

    的产品模拟量采集模块更好? 模拟量采集器是一种智能采集模块,
    发表于 04-20 15:35 4622次阅读

    0-10V模拟量或RS485转PWM输出隔离转换器

    0-10V 模拟量或 RS485 转 PWM 输出隔离转换器 LED 灯光亮度调节 电磁阀、比例阀门线性驱动器 模拟量电机控制器 电磁驱动线圈或大功率负载 RS-485 远程设备控制
    发表于 04-11 10:00 1358次阅读
    <b class='flag-5'>0-10V</b><b class='flag-5'>模拟量</b>或RS485转PWM输出隔离转换器

    0-10V模拟量或RS485转PWM输出隔离转换器

    0-10V 模拟量或 RS485 转 PWM 输出隔离转换器可选择RS485 通讯输入,支持 Modbus 协议 PWM 信号输出,PWM 频率可选 WM 输出驱动能力可达 5A 可选择一进一出,
    发表于 04-18 10:44 1254次阅读
    <b class='flag-5'>0-10V</b><b class='flag-5'>模拟量</b>或RS485转PWM输出隔离转换器

    2路模拟量说明书

    模拟量采集精度达到1‰,支持多种量程采集,内置跳线量程技术,支持0-20ma,4-20ma,0-5V0
    发表于 08-06 13:40 1次下载

    4路模拟量说明书

    高精度模拟量采集模块,采集精度达到1‰,内置跳线量程技术,支持多种量程采集,支持0-20ma,4-20ma,
    发表于 08-06 13:54 2次下载

    8路模拟量说明书

    工业级8路模拟量信号采集模块,模拟量采集精度达到1‰,支持多种量程采集,内置跳线量程技术,支持0
    发表于 08-06 14:05 14次下载

    单片机处理模拟量的程序流程是如何的

    单片机处理模拟量的程序流程是一种常见的应用场景,单片机通常被用来处理各种类型的传感器信号,例如温度传感器、压力传感器、光敏传感器等。在本文中,我将详尽地描述
    的头像 发表于 12-15 09:28 1533次阅读